The Growing Importance of Remote Hands Services
Remote hands services refer to technical support provided on-site at a data center by skilled personnel, often on behalf of a remote client. These services typically include tasks such as hardware installations, troubleshooting, server reboots, cable management, and other routine maintenance duties. For international businesses that maintain colocation servers in Amsterdam’s data centers, remote hands represent an essential extension of their internal IT teams, especially when on-site presence is impractical or costly.

Why Amsterdam?
Amsterdam is renowned for its advanced data center ecosystem, attracting a broad spectrum of international businesses. The city’s proximity to major internet exchange points, coupled with its extensive fiber optic network, ensures minimal latency and high-speed connectivity—an essential factor for modern colocation server setups.
Furthermore, Amsterdam benefits from a mature regulatory framework and commitment to sustainability, aspects increasingly prioritized by global businesses. This environment fosters trust and reliability, making it an ideal location for housing sensitive data and critical infrastructure.
International enterprises operating in diverse time zones also find Amsterdam remote hands services invaluable. The time difference often prevents internal IT teams from addressing urgent on-site needs promptly. Remote hands services ensure that essential data center operations, such as hardware reboots or emergency fixes, are handled quickly without waiting for personnel to travel internationally.

Benefits for International Businesses
For global enterprises, partnering with Amsterdam remote hands providers delivers numerous advantages:
Cost Efficiency: Employing dedicated IT staff to travel and manage overseas colocation servers is expensive and inefficient. Remote hands services reduce travel costs and allow businesses to scale support based on need rather than permanent staffing.
Improved Uptime: Fast response times to issues such as server failures or network problems translate into higher uptime and better service levels. This reliability directly influences customer satisfaction and trust.
Access to Local Expertise: Remote hands technicians understand the specific infrastructure and regulatory environment of Amsterdam’s data centers, ensuring compliance and optimized performance.
Time Zone Alignment: International businesses benefit from technicians working in the same or similar time zones, overcoming delays caused by communication and operational mismatches.
Focus on Core Competencies: By outsourcing data center operations and maintenance tasks, companies can focus their internal resources on strategic projects, innovation, and business growth.
